Chris Crossing Team Awarded for Raising €116K for Beaumont

Tuesday, 14 March, 2017

Some 12 months ago we were contacted by a Garda who proposed the idea that he and his 12 colleagues would row across the Irish Sea to raise funds in support of Chris Byrne (the husband of their garda colleague) who at the time was undergoing treatment for a brain tumour. They hoped to raise €50,000.

However, only a short time later, Chris sadly passed away but the team were determined to continue on with the challenge which became known as The Chris Crossing.

The team of 12 gardai along with Chris's brother Eugene rowed from Holyhead to Dublin port in June 2016 and their total fundraising for the National Neurosurgical Centre now rests at an amazing €116,000.

The Chris Crossing's incredible effort was acknowledged by the Garda members at the annual Coiste Siamsa Awards in Cork where they received the Special Contribution Award from their garda colleagues.
